Yes, stainless steel cookware is compatible with induction stovetops. Look for cookware that has a magnetic bottom, as this ensures proper heat transfer on induction surfaces.
Most stainless steel cookware is dishwasher safe. However, to maintain its shine and prolong its lifespan, it is recommended to hand wash stainless steel cookware using mild dish soap and a non-abrasive sponge.
For stubborn stains or discoloration, you can try using a mixture of baking soda and water or a stainless steel cleaner. Apply the solution to the affected areas, scrub gently, and rinse thoroughly.
Yes, most stainless steel cookware is oven safe. However, it's important to check the manufacturer's instructions for the specific temperature limits and any other guidelines for safe oven use.
Yes, stainless steel cookware is generally compatible with metal utensils. However, to prevent scratching or damaging the surface, it is recommended to use silicone, wooden, or nylon utensils.
